About the role
OHDELA (Ohio Distance and Electronic Learning Academy) is a tuition-free, K-12 online school dedicated to transforming education through a state-of-the-art virtual experience. We offer a flexible, standards-aligned curriculum delivered by highly qualified teachers, providing 24/7 access to learning. As a premier online academy, we tailor our instruction to meet the unique needs of every student-from advanced learners to those seeking a safe, bully-free environment. We are seeking a Virtual Special Education Coordinator who is dedicated to providing a superior education for all students! We are seeking candidates who are excited to create a rigorous and nurturing classroom environment that prioritizes student learning and social-emotional development. Please note - while this is an online school position and all instruction occurs virtually, travel and face to face attendance will be required several times per year to support in person state testing and student events. Eligibility: Open to all residents of Ohio Oversight and development of innovative special education services to meet diverse student needs and ensure quality of education and compliance Contribute to the leadership team working as an active member of the Administrative Staff; assist in the development and training of the total school philosophy of special education Ensure maintenance of all special education student records and files in accordance with timelines and guidelines as established by state law and the Department of Education best practices Suggest/develop new policies, procedures or changes essential to special education programs and compliance Hold a reduced caseload of students Maintain compliance with paperwork and service time for the assigned caseload Maintain confidentiality concerning all student information and any professional matters Work with the teaching staff to improve standardized and proficiency testing results Assist in hiring and oversee the training of all Special Education staff Act as point of contact with all agencies providing related services to students, manage contracts and agreements related to services in collaboration with supervisor. Participate in ongoing training to enhance professional skills Provide resources for Special Education staff In collaboration with the Testing Manager, track and plan for provision of all documented student accommodations for state and district testing Act as point of contact for outside agencies and service providers working with students Collaborate with the State Reporting Coordinator to ensure all data for Special Education students is accurately captured and reported Participate in such other activities as directed: faculty meetings (before or after school hours), open houses, commencement exercises, chaperone student activities, provide guidance for students, participate in professional learning communities, study and help resolve school problems, and participate in the preparation of courses of study -- these activities demonstrate valuable support for the school Perform student home visits as required Serve as LEA/District Rep for special education meetings Perform other duties as assigned About You: Bachelor's Degree minimum, Master's Degree preferred Proficient in computer applications, including MS Office Suite, Google applications, e-mail, and internet applications; excellent verbal and written communication skills Exhibit genuine care for children and a passion for teaching Strong ability to gather, analyze, and interpret student data to make sound educational decisions Exhibit flexibility with regard to decision-making, daily challenges, and job duties Has strong sense of integrity Has a "team player" attitude Ability to work in a diverse educational community setting Understanding of the community and student demographics Understanding of the RTI process Understand state proficiency testing as well as state teaching standards Satisfactory completion of state required criminal history check and health tests Physical ability to lift up to 25 pounds "We believe that every child should be able to be anything they want in life, regardless of their birthplace and circumstances." - Ron Packard, CEO & Founder ACCEL Schools is a network of 80+ high-performing, public charter schools serving PK-12 students.
